一、区块链钱包简介

区块链钱包是用于存储、发送和接收加密货币(如比特币、以太坊等)的工具。钱包通常不直接存储货币,而是保存管理这些货币所需的私钥和公钥。通过区块链技术,用户可以安全地进行交易而不必依赖中央机构。

区块链钱包主要分为热钱包和冷钱包。热钱包连接到互联网,通常用于日常交易;而冷钱包则是离线存储,更加安全,但在交易时需要额外步骤来连接网络。

二、私钥与公钥的概念

私钥和公钥是区块链加密机制的核心。公钥是用户的地址,其他人可以通过它向用户发送加密货币;而私钥则是控制这些资产的钥匙,只有拥有私钥的人才能进行资金的转移。

私钥应当被严格保护,因为一旦私钥被他人获得,相应的加密货币就会面临被盗的风险。因此,了解如何安全管理和使用私钥,是所有加密货币用户必须掌握的基本知识。

三、区块链钱包的签名过程

区块链交易的签名过程是确保交易合法性的一种方式。用户在发起交易时,会使用其私钥对交易数据进行签名,产生一个数字签名。这个数字签名是独特的,任何人都无法伪造。

数字签名的过程也表明了用户的意图——即确认某笔交易是由私钥的持有者发起的。然而,用户在生成签名的过程中,是否会暴露私钥呢?

四、私钥泄露的风险

在理想情况下,区块链钱包的设计是不会让私钥泄露的。当用户发起交易并签名时,私钥并不会被直接暴露在互联网上或在其他地方被存储。

然而,私钥泄露依然是可能的,例如通过恶意软件、钓鱼网站或不安全的网络连接来获取私钥所在的设备。用户在使用钱包应用时,需要注意以下几点,以降低私钥泄露的风险:

  • 使用可信赖的钱包应用,并定期更新软件。
  • 在安全的网络环境下进行交易,避免公共Wi-Fi。
  • 启用双因素认证,增加安全性。
  • 定期备份私钥并安全保管,避免丢失。

五、关于区块链钱包签名和私钥泄露的常见问题

在探讨区块链钱包和私钥安全性时,用户常常会有一些疑问,以下是五个相关的问题及详细解答。

区块链钱包怎样保证私钥的安全?

区块链钱包通过多种方式确保私钥的安全。在热钱包中,私钥通常是加密存储的,需要解密才能使用。冷钱包如硬件钱包则完全离线存储私钥,进一步降低了被攻击的风险。

此外,许多钱包采用了多重签名技术,在转账前需要多把私钥的签名才能完成交易,这增加了私钥被盗取的难度。同时,定期的安全更新和防病毒软件也有助于保护用户的数据。

最后,用户应该定期检查未授权的交易,并尽量选择加密货币历史良好的钱包提供商。

签名交易时,私钥会被暴露吗?

简单来说,正规的区块链钱包在创建签名时不会暴露私钥。私钥在加密钱包内进行操作,不会被传输到其他地方。因此,签名过程本身是安全的。

然而,使用第三方服务可能会引起风险,如果用户在不安全的网站上输入私钥,一定会面临被盗的危机。因此,用户一定要确保使用信誉良好的钱包和平台,任何时候都不要向任何第三方透露自己的私钥。

私钥泄露后如何保护资产?

如果私钥已经泄露,那么尽快采取措施来保护资产是至关重要的。第一步是立即转移任何可用资产到一个新的钱包上,新的钱包需要生成一个新的私钥和助记词,确保之前的私钥不被使用。

其次,要在新的钱包中启用双重认证等安全措施,增强安全性。此外,还要密切监视任何可疑活动,并及时与所在平台的支持部门联系以获得帮助。

如果觉得自己的资产处于极大风险中,可以考虑咨询专业的区块链安全团队,作为增强安全性的一部分。

使用硬件钱包是否能完全杜绝私钥泄露的风险?

硬件钱包提供了相对更高的安全性,因为它们的私钥是驻留在设备内部并离线存储的。然而,任何设备都不是绝对安全的,硬件钱包也可能遭受物理攻击、制造缺陷和其它潜在风险。

为了最大限度地降低风险,用户应该从官方渠道购买硬件钱包,并在首次使用时确保进行安全配置。例如,设定强密码,启用开机认证等。

同时,用户必须了解其使用的硬件钱包所带有的技术特性,并保持对其软件的及时更新。最终,用户的安全意识和安全实践仍然是保护私钥的重要因素。

选择区块链钱包时,有哪些注意事项?

选择合适的区块链钱包是确保私钥安全的第一步。用户在选择钱包时,可以考虑以下几个方面:

  • 信誉与口碑:了解社区对该钱包的评价,以及是否有被黑客攻击的历史。
  • 开源与透明性:开源钱包代码可以让用户和开发者共同审核其安全性,增加透明度。
  • 用户体验:钱包的易用性也是一个重要因素,友好的用户界面可以减少操作错误。
  • 安全功能:查看钱包是否具有多重签名、双因素认证等额外的安全措施。
  • 客服支持:良好的客户服务可以在遇到问题时提供及时的帮助。

结论

区块链钱包的签名过程本身并不会直接泄露私钥,安全性取决于用户的使用习惯和选择的钱包工具。通过采取适当的预防措施和对钱包的合理选择,用户可以大大降低私钥泄露的风险。

无论是从技术细节还是安全意识的角度,加强防范,确保资产安全,是每一位区块链用户的责任。